Have you ever struggled to stick to a budget, despite your best efforts and good intentions? I know how discouraging it feels when financial plans collapse, even though you’re trying hard. In this episode of Financially Confident Christian, I address the common frustrations and obstacles people face with budgeting. We explore why budgets fail and the importance of consistent expense tracking and effective money management. I explain why financial struggles are often caused by overly complicated or unrealistic structures, not a lack of discipline. By simplifying categories, tracking expenses, and staying mindful of small expenditures, I’ve found that peace and progress in how to budget replace stress and defeat.
In Episode 11, “Overspent Again? Adjust Without Shame”, I showed how flexibility and faith can turn overspending into growth. Building on that, this episode focuses on persistence and patience as the keys to long‑term success. I share practical advice on basing budgets on historical data and making steady, small adjustments that last. I encourage you to see budgeting as a journey of progress rather than perfection.
